Raven Tools from the Tennessee company of the same name is Internet or search engine marketing optimization software consisting of popular tools targeted at SEO specialists who need research automation. To that end it contains the familiar set of website research and auditing, competitor monitoring, rank tracking, and also content investigation to see that material on the site is keyword-rich yet topically relevant. I would say RavenTools is most appropriate if you find you are spending a lot of time logging into different services and generating different reports from each. It's been a big time saver for us because we can compile all that data into one report and even generate a cover page and table of contents. This suite has also been beneficial for our sales team in that they we can provide detailed reports on the problems with their website before we even close the deal with them.
Recently switching domains provided a lot of headaches for our marketing team. However, with Serpstat we were able to locate all our broken links and contact all the editors to be able to update our link. This alone took us from a DR of 25 to 34. Another practical use was for researching keyword volume for our on-page SEO - title tags and meta descriptions. With Serpstat we were able to determine keywords were worthy of us using in these values.

A year ago or so, Raven abandoned many of their organic rank reporting tools in an attempt to favor some Adwords intelligence. The market rebelled, as did I; in our desperation to find an alternative to Raven, none could be found and a great majority of users didn't want/need Adwords data. Months later, Raven reverted. I'd renew with Raven not just because nothing else cuts it, but because they are both trying to innovate, and listening to customers.

RavenTools has absolutely improved the reporting we provide our clients. We used to be mashing together dissimilar Excel reports. Comparisons between time periods was difficult to present and graphs had to be created manually with lots of time spent formatting them correctly.
RavenTools has improved the efficiency with which we put together our reports. This frees us up to do more high-level thinking about recommendations and up-sell opportunities which ultimately leads to more revenue.
